Toward a Definition of Secular Humanism.
Farmer, Rod
Contemporary Education, v58 n3 p126-30 Spr 1987
This article describes secular humanism and refutes arguments that secular humanism is a religion and, as such, is practiced by most educators. It concludes that knowledge is the most important tool for combatting evangelical right-wing or extreme left-wing movements. (MT)
